Project Manager / MO Scheduling Lead
Career Level: CL9 Specialist
Location: Birmingham

Salary: competitive package

These professionals take responsibility for end-to-end solution delivery and accuracy of work processes, ensures timely delivery of high quality project deliverables by proactively identifying and mitigating risks, communicating effectively, and understanding the s of their team members.

Key Responsibilities

  • Manages project scope and supports the process of identifying project requirements.
  • Provides support to production team to remove roadblocks and clarify questions, assigns appropriate owners to prevent issues and enhance performance.
  • Proactively manages and monitors execution of deliverables, project status, and reporting of overall project status.
  • Manages all change requests, validates all schedule and budget impacts, and communicates approved changes to all stakeholders, ensures timely delivery of high-quality deliverables including but not limited to all change requests.
  • Demonstrates creativity and flexibility when creating and driving project plans, determines needed deliverables, high level approach, project profile, responsible teams, critical path by deliverable, productivity improvements, overall risks and planning assumptions using Accenture Delivery Methods (ADM) as required.
  • Supports the stand-up execution of a new project, assumes responsibility for the accuracy of work processes and flow of tasks, understands and defines various s that teams play in the process.
  • Demonstrates experience managing project schedule and prioritizing tasks based on critical path, determines overall project schedule and timeline.
  • Demonstrates experience validating and creating time estimations, drives estimates by deliverable and works with teams to optimize and reduce overall estimates.
  • Understands and applies basic financial concepts, leads budget management on a project with the help of a more senior lead.
  • Demonstrates experience creating basic project cost estimations and has cost management skills.
  • Ensures that the project tracking tools are populated correctly, ensures processes are documented and followed, assesses completed work for quality and accuracy and that team members are following quality assurance processes.
  • Identifies opportunities for improving processes and helps project resources to find opportunities to improve project productivity within the operation.
  • Demonstrates good experience working with multicultural teams, understands and factors in the cultural diversity of the audience when planning communications.
  • Proactively assigns work and provides instructions, monitor team performance and advice production team to complete their assignments, identifies ways for team members to better engage in knowledge-sharing and collaboration across teams, takes responsibility for developing team members by providing regular constructive feedback.
  • Mentors and provides guidance to project resources to continually improve project productivity, coach others to improve their problem-solving abilities.
  • Actively participates on interviews to provide expert criteria on selection processes.
  • Reports and manages overall project/release status back to the project sponsor and stakeholders, proactively reports on execution of deliverables.
  • Demonstrates experience managing communication plan at project level, is a master communicator across multiple stakeholders, effectively communicates ideas to team members, creates communication strategy for the team/project with clear objectives and expectations.
  • Creates, validates, and applies risk mitigation plan at the project level, escalates issues to management that cannot be resolved at the project level, ensures stakeholders understand what risks will or will not be mitigated.
  • Builds trust relationships with client and main project stakeholders, exerts a positive influence on stakeholders and clients, reports overall project status to stakeholders, guides team members on maintaining a relationship with stakeholders and clients, predicts client issues and raises concerns to supervisor.
  • Demonstrates experience managing escalations at project level, ensures resolution of project risks, proactively identify and mitigates conflicts by assigning appropriate owners to enhance performance.
